Seeking a Principal Full Stack Engineer to join our dynamic team. The ideal candidate is a seasoned software engineer who excels in designing and building complex software applications across the entire stack, particularly in single-page applications (SPA) or back-office systems.
Requirements
- Excellent communication skills and the ability to work well in a team environment.
- 8+ years of experience developing web applications in client-side frameworks such as React, Angular, VueJS, etc.
- Excellent understanding of object-oriented JavaScript and TypeScript.
- Proven experience working on large-scale projects, particularly in single-page applications (SPA) or back-office systems.
- Extensive experience in optimizing the performance of web applications.
- Deep knowledge of software engineering principles and advanced design patterns.
- Extensive experience with backend technologies and frameworks commonly used in web development, 6+ years preferred.
- Strong expertise in RESTful API design and GraphQL
- Extensive familiarity with database management systems such as PostgreSQL, MySQL, etc.
Benefits
- Well-funded start-up
- Be part of one of the fastest-growing B2B SaaS start-ups in the region
- You will be collaborating with talented individuals in the industry
- Join a lively and highly international team
- Indulge in a challenging and innovative working culture
- Attractive medical healthcare plan
- Personal development allowance
- 2 weeks of work from anywhere per year
- Regular fun team-building activities
- Company trip